CARD OF THANKS.
We wish to express our thankfulness to our friends for their love and kindness to us during the illness and death of our beloved wife and mother, Mrs. Sallie Shearer.
We especially thank the doctors and nurses of Magee Hospital, and also wish to express our appreciation for the beautiful floral offerings. May our many prayers be for you all.
S. S. SHEARER, and Family.

Question came up to whether the parent's attached were hers. They are. Sallie's parents are correct and so is her sister, Florence's. These two daughter's headstone birth dates are within 9 months of each other. The mother's obituary states that her daughter, Mrs. Sidney Shearer preceded her in death by one week. The obituary for Florence says she was 100 so her birth year would have been 1880 not 1882.
1900 census has Sallie's birth date as Mar 1882 and her headstone has 7 Mar 1882.
